Performance of wind energy conversion system using a Permanent Magnet Synchronous Generator for maximum power point tracking
This paper present a control method which tracks the maximum power point for a wind energy conversion system based on Permanent Magnet Synchronous Generator (PMSG) fed by back to back voltage source converter. The control strategy for the generator with maximum power extraction is presented. The MPPT control algorithm is presented based on perturb and observe method. The algorithm operates at two modes. Mode-1 obtains the maximum power point (Pref). In the next mode Pref is kept unchanged till this mode calculates the new value of optimum power at new wind speed. Simulation results shows that the controllers can extract the maximum power.
